Excel数据库建立方法详解,如何快速搭建高效数据库?
在Excel中建立数据库主要包括:1、确定数据结构与字段;2、规范数据输入格式;3、利用表格功能组织和管理数据;4、实现数据的查询与分析。 这些步骤帮助用户高效地整理和管理大量信息,使Excel具备类似数据库的功能。以“规范数据输入格式”为例,只有确保每一列专注于一个特定类型的数据(如姓名、电话等),并避免合并单元格或多行描述同一条记录,才能保障后续查询、筛选和分析的准确性。此外,可以通过设置数据有效性规则和使用表格工具,进一步提升数据的一致性和完整性,从而为后续的数据处理打下坚实基础。
《excel里如何建立数据库》
一、明确需求与设计数据库结构
- 在Excel中建立数据库前,首先需明确自身的数据管理需求,例如客户信息管理、库存统计还是销售记录等。
- 合理设计表结构,包括表头(字段)、字段类型及其关系,是高效数据库运行的基础。
核心步骤
| 步骤 | 说明 |
|---|---|
| 明确目标 | 确定需要存储的数据类型及用途 |
| 列出字段 | 比如姓名、手机号、地址等,每类信息为一列 |
| 规划主键 | 如序号或ID,确保每条记录唯一 |
| 字段命名规范 | 鼓励英文/拼音命名,无特殊字符 |
背景说明
合理的数据结构有助于后续查询、筛选以及数据处理。例如,在客户信息表中,将“姓名”、“手机号”、“邮箱”分别放在不同列,而非将所有信息写进一个单元格,这样便于查找某一客户或批量操作。设计时还应考虑未来可能扩展的字段,为后续升级留有空间。
二、标准化录入——保证数据一致性
Excel虽非传统意义上的关系型数据库,但通过标准化操作可大幅提升其“类数据库”能力:
标准化方法
- 每行代表一条独立记录,不跨行合并。
- 每列仅承载一种属性,如电话只能填数字,不混杂字母。
- 利用“数据有效性”功能,限制录入内容(如下拉选择、省市区限定)。
- 禁止空白行,以防筛选或排序时遗漏部分内容。
- 字段长度统一,比如身份证号全部18位。
实例说明
假如你要管理员工档案,下表为标准化示例:
| 员工编号 | 姓名 | 性别 | 入职日期 | 手机号码 | 部门 |
|---|---|---|---|---|---|
| 10001 | 王小明 | 男 | 2020/5/10 | 13812345678 | 市场部 |
| 10002 | 李红 | 女 | 2021/3/15 | 13987654321 | 财务部 |
通过上述方式,可确保所有员工资料完整、一致且易于检索。
三、利用Excel内置功能强化“类数据库”能力
Excel 提供丰富工具,能让普通表格变身为简易数据库:
表格工具应用
- 利用“格式化为表格”,自动添加筛选按钮,并支持动态扩展;
- 应用条件格式,高亮显示重复值或异常;
- 用公式(VLOOKUP/XLOOKUP)实现跨表查找;
- 用筛选/排序快速定位关键信息;
- 使用“分组汇总”进行多层级分类统计;
- 数据透视表,实现灵活汇总与分析。
功能对比分析
| 功能名称 | 数据库意义 | Excel实现方式 |
|---|---|---|
| 唯一主键 | 区分唯一记录 | 新增ID列,自动编号 |
| 字段约束 | 保证输入合法 | 数据有效性设置,下拉菜单等 |
| 查询 | 按条件查找 | 筛选、高级筛选 |
| 多维统计 | 汇总分组 | 数据透视表 |
四、安全与协作——共享与权限设置
传统关系型数据库可细粒度控制权限,而Excel虽有限制,但也有一些安全协作办法:
实现方式
- 文件加密保护:设置打开密码、防止更改密码。
- 工作表保护:可锁定某些区域
精品问答:
Excel里如何建立数据库?
我刚开始接触Excel,想知道如何用Excel建立一个简单的数据库。对于没有专业数据库知识的人来说,这个过程复杂吗?用Excel建立数据库有哪些基本步骤?
在Excel里建立数据库主要包括以下步骤:
- 规划数据结构:确定需要记录的字段(如姓名、年龄、地址等),确保字段名清晰且唯一。
- 创建表格:在Excel工作表中,第一行为字段标题,后续行填写具体数据。
- 使用表格功能:通过“插入”→“表格”将数据区域转换为表格,便于筛选和排序。
- 数据验证与格式设置:利用“数据验证”功能限制输入类型,提高数据准确性。
- 利用筛选和排序功能快速查找和整理数据。 举例来说,如果你要创建员工信息库,先列出“员工ID”、“姓名”、“部门”、“入职日期”等字段,再录入对应信息,通过以上步骤形成基础数据库结构。
怎样用Excel实现基本的数据查询功能?
我想知道在Excel建好数据库后,怎么快速查询特定条件的数据,比如找到所有销售部员工的信息,有没有简单易懂的方法?
Excel提供多种查询方式来实现数据检索,常见方法包括:
| 方法 | 操作说明 | 适用场景 |
|---|---|---|
| 筛选(Filter) | 点击表头筛选按钮选择条件 | 快速查看符合条件的部分记录 |
| 查找(Find) | 使用Ctrl + F搜索关键词 | 定位单一值或关键词 |
| 函数查询 | 使用VLOOKUP、INDEX+MATCH函数进行复杂匹配 | 根据键值提取相关信息 |
例如,要查询销售部员工,可以点击部门列的筛选按钮,仅选择“销售部”,即可显示所有相关人员信息。这样能大幅提升数据处理效率。
Excel里的数据表如何设计才能提高数据库性能和可维护性?
我听说好的数据表设计能让数据库运行更高效,也更容易维护。但我不太懂这些设计原则,在Excel里应该注意哪些方面?
为了提升Excel数据库的性能与可维护性,应遵循以下设计原则:
- 避免合并单元格:合并单元格会干扰筛选和排序功能。
- 字段命名规范:使用简洁且描述性的标题,如“客户ID”而非模糊名称。
- 数据类型统一:同一列保持一致的数据格式,例如日期列全部设置为日期格式。
- 分离重复信息:避免冗余字段,将重复内容拆分到不同工作表,通过唯一标识符关联。
- 使用命名单元区域便于引用,提高公式准确性。
举例来说,如果你有多个订单记录,应将客户信息独立存储,而订单表通过客户ID引用客户详情,从而减少重复输入,提高准确率。
在Excel中建立数据库时如何保证数据的安全性和完整性?
我担心别人误删或修改我的重要数据,还有怎样防止输入错误导致的数据混乱,有什么方法能保护我的Excel数据库吗?
保证Excel数据库安全性和完整性的关键措施包括:
- 工作表保护与权限设置:通过“审阅”→“保护工作表”限制编辑权限,防止误操作。
- 数据验证规则应用:设定输入范围及类型,如限制数字范围、日期格式等,减少错误录入概率。
- 定期备份文件:采用版本管理,每日或周期备份防止意外丢失。
- 使用密码加密文件,提高文件访问安全性。
- 利用宏或脚本自动检测异常值或重复项,实现自动化监控。例如,通过设置电话号码字段只能输入11位数字,可有效避免无效号码录入。结合这些措施,可以显著提升你的Excel数据库稳健性和安全等级。
文章版权归"
转载请注明出处:https://www.jiandaoyun.com/nblog/83159/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com
删除。